Chablis

Classic

White · Medium · Dry

Chardonnay grown on Burgundy's chalkiest soils, almost never oaked. Lean, steely, oyster-shell minerality; a wine that tastes like a place. The wine for shellfish, full stop.

Chinon Red

Adventurous

Red · Medium · Dry

Loire Cabernet Franc at its most refined — pencil-shavings, raspberry, and a flint-stone finish. The bistro red of choice; equally good chilled in summer.
